Output 75b599ef3e997127ddaf84ac424438f0683b41ae144924c7510d0ee1a3e569fa:1

value
5886040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49a933b23d0c5054c85b6d903ac205bab524d56b OP_EQUALVERIFY OP_CHECKSIG
address
17iV2MuQkyLqq7PCZauynaukSn5VaRcP6K
transaction
75b599ef3e997127ddaf84ac424438f0683b41ae144924c7510d0ee1a3e569fa
spent
true